Car keys have actually come a long way since the early days of automotive history. Initially, car keys were easy mechanical devices. Nevertheless, with the advent of technology, they have become more advanced and safe. Today, there are several kinds of car keys, each requiring specialized understanding and tools:
Traditional Metal Keys: These are the simplest and many basic type of car keys. They are used to lock and open the car's doors and spark the engine. A locksmith can easily replicate these keys utilizing a key-cutting device.
Transponder Keys: These keys consist of a microchip that interacts with the car's immobilizer system to enable the engine to start. Replicating and programming a transponder key is more complicated and requires customized devices.
Remote Head Keys: These keys have a remote control incorporated into the key head, permitting the motorist to lock and unlock the car from a distance. A locksmith can program the remote functions of these keys.
Keyless Entry and Start Systems: Modern lorries often feature keyless entry and begin systems, which utilize a fob or a smartphone app to unlock and start the car. Locksmith professionals can aid with the programming and troubleshooting of these systems.
Smart Keys: These keys are extremely advanced and can perform multiple functions, such as beginning the car, locking and unlocking doors, and changing seat positions. Locksmith professionals require to be fluent in the most recent technologies to work with smart keys.

Q: How long does it take to replicate a car key?
A: Duplicating a standard metal key can take simply a few minutes. Nevertheless, programming a transponder or smart key can use up to an hour, depending on the complexity of the key and the locksmith's equipment.
Q: Can a mobile locksmith for cars program a key for a car with a keyless entry system?
A: Yes, locksmiths can program keys for cars and trucks with keyless entry systems. They utilize specialized programming tools and frequently need to access the car's on-board computer system to complete the task.
Q: What should I do if I lose my car key and do not have a spare?
A: If you lose your car key and do not have a spare, the very best course of action is to contact a professional locksmith. They can create a brand-new key and program it to deal with your vehicle's security system.
Q: How much does it cost to get a car key programmed by a locksmith?
A: The expense of programming a car key can differ depending upon the kind of key and the make and model of the vehicle. Normally, it can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200 or more.
Q: Can I program a car key myself?
A: Some vehicles permit for DIY key programming, however this is frequently a complex procedure that can result in mistakes. It is generally advised to seek the support of a professional locksmith to guarantee that the key is programmed correctly.
Q: Are locksmith professionals trained to deal with all types of cars?
A: Most expert locksmiths are trained to deal with a wide variety of vehicle makes and models. However, it is always a good concept to confirm that the locksmith has experience with your specific type of car.
